As an Airport Supervisor of Training & Compliance (Bargaining Unit, Local 25) you are a hands‑on aviation operations professional who thrives in a dynamic airport environment where safety, security, training, and operational continuity are critical to success. You confidently lead and educate others, build strong partnerships with airlines, tenants, regulatory agencies, and internal stakeholders, remain composed during emergencies and operational disruptions, and leverage sound judgment to solve complex challenges while ensuring a safe, secure, and seamless experience for passengers, employees, and the airport community.

What

You Will Do
  • Support the safe, secure, and efficient operation of Logan Airport through operational readiness, workforce training, regulatory compliance, and the continuous development of staff knowledge and capabilities.
  • Serve as a trusted operational partner, fostering productive relationships with airlines, tenants, government agencies, contractors, and internal stakeholders to address challenges, coordinate solutions, and enhance the overall passenger and stakeholder experience.
  • Provide leadership and sound judgment during emergencies, security incidents, weather events, and operational disruptions, ensuring timely decision‑making, effective communication, and coordinated responses that minimize operational impacts while prioritizing safety and security.
  • Coordinate complex airport operations, special events, seasonal initiatives, and critical operational activities, balancing competing priorities to maintain service continuity, support regulatory requirements, and deliver a seamless experience for passengers, employees, tenants, and the broader airport community.
What You Offer
  • 3–5 years of experience in airport operations, airline operations, or a related aviation environment, with demonstrated operational knowledge and industry expertise.
  • At least 2 years of supervisory or leadership experience, with the ability to guide teams, coordinate activities, and support operational excellence.
  • Strong technical proficiency, including Microsoft Office and the ability to quickly learn and utilize operational, training, and web‑based systems.
  • Ability to obtain and maintain all required licenses, certifications, security clearances, and badges, including airfield driving privileges and compliance with Massport’s background screening requirements.
